Number of deaths in Ireland in 2013, by cause
This statistic displays the number of deaths by cause in Ireland in 2013, by gender. Cancer (except stomach cancer, colorectal cancer, lung cancer and breast cancer as they are accounted for separately) was the leading cause of death among individuals in Ireland with approximately 2.2 thousand females and 2.9 thousand males dying from the disease. Ischaemic heart disease was the second leading cause of death.
